aboutsummaryrefslogtreecommitdiffstats
path: root/lib/Target/Mips/MCTargetDesc/MipsMCTargetDesc.h
diff options
context:
space:
mode:
authorAkira Hatanaka <ahatanaka@mips.com>2011-09-30 21:23:45 +0000
committerAkira Hatanaka <ahatanaka@mips.com>2011-09-30 21:23:45 +0000
commit4b6ee7a35213709c057cdd073fb27bda09fa3359 (patch)
tree47af7df60a58d6c0808890fd9ca748f46aae0e20 /lib/Target/Mips/MCTargetDesc/MipsMCTargetDesc.h
parent82ea7314ca52c9df8e1b6600231fafb7ae722313 (diff)
downloadexternal_llvm-4b6ee7a35213709c057cdd073fb27bda09fa3359.zip
external_llvm-4b6ee7a35213709c057cdd073fb27bda09fa3359.tar.gz
external_llvm-4b6ee7a35213709c057cdd073fb27bda09fa3359.tar.bz2
Register Asm backend. Add functions to MipsAsmBackend.
Patch by Reed Kotler at Mips Technologies. git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@140886 91177308-0d34-0410-b5e6-96231b3b80d8
Diffstat (limited to 'lib/Target/Mips/MCTargetDesc/MipsMCTargetDesc.h')
-rw-r--r--lib/Target/Mips/MCTargetDesc/MipsMCTargetDesc.h3
1 files changed, 3 insertions, 0 deletions
diff --git a/lib/Target/Mips/MCTargetDesc/MipsMCTargetDesc.h b/lib/Target/Mips/MCTargetDesc/MipsMCTargetDesc.h
index cb817c2..7a0042a 100644
--- a/lib/Target/Mips/MCTargetDesc/MipsMCTargetDesc.h
+++ b/lib/Target/Mips/MCTargetDesc/MipsMCTargetDesc.h
@@ -15,6 +15,7 @@
#define MIPSMCTARGETDESC_H
namespace llvm {
+class MCAsmBackend;
class MCInstrInfo;
class MCCodeEmitter;
class MCContext;
@@ -30,6 +31,8 @@ extern Target TheMips64elTarget;
MCCodeEmitter *createMipsMCCodeEmitter(const MCInstrInfo &MCII,
const MCSubtargetInfo &STI,
MCContext &Ctx);
+
+MCAsmBackend *createMipsAsmBackend(const Target &T, StringRef TT);
} // End llvm namespace
// Defines symbolic names for Mips registers. This defines a mapping from